> On Sun, 2006-04-23 at 19:39 +0200, Marcos Guglielmetti Gmail wrote:
> > Hi,
> >
> > Does the current kernel-source (2.6.16.9) has the new ALSA 1.0.11?
> >
> > I did not found any details looking at: http://www.kernel.org/
> > about the new ALSA 1.0.11
> >
> > I did a search with google:
> >
> > alsa 1.0.11 site:http://www.kernel.org/
>
> Nope, 1.0.11rc2.  2.6.17 should have ALSA 1.0.11.
>
> Lee

Ok, thanks. I think I will use the new Kernel 2.6.17, I think that it's 
better than use any old kernels and compile alsa-modules for them...
